Leadership Review Briefing — Legacy Pricing Adjustment

Legacy customers on pre-2019 Quillhaven contracts will see a 9% increase at renewal. Affects roughly 1,400 accounts, mostly in the Merrowdale and Ashgate branches. Expected attrition: under 4%. Branch managers should prepare retention scripts but offer no exceptions without regional sign-off. Revenue uplift projected at mid single digits annually. Rationale and next steps are set out in the confidential note below.

internal memo for hahif-hahaf: Headcount on the Zorwyn team goes from 9 to 100 by the end of October. Gross margin on Zorwyn came in at 5 percent against a plan of 10 percent.

Validator plugins for Grovelint load from /opt/grovelint/plugins at boot. Each plugin must export a manifest and a check() hook; bad manifests fail closed. Restart the worker pool after adding or removing plugins — hot reload is not supported. Plugins that call the registry need the signing token from the env file. Add the following line to plugins.env:

sealed setting: ARCHIVE_KEY3=8d0

**Vendor note: Inkmill markdown pipeline**

Rendering for Parchway docs is outsourced to Inkmill under an annual contract, renewing each March. They handle sanitization and PDF export; we own the upload queue. SLA: 4-hour response on rendering failures. Escalate only after two failed retries. Their support desk is reachable at the address below.

billing contact of hahaf-baguf = zorael.tammir.jorius@sivrelhq.internal